Alicia Torre is a scholar working on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, Physical and Theoretical Chemistry and Spectroscopy. According to data from OpenAlex, Alicia Torre has authored 130 papers receiving a total of 1.8k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 98 papers in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, 31 papers in Physical and Theoretical Chemistry and 26 papers in Spectroscopy. Recurrent topics in Alicia Torre’s work include Advanced Chemical Physics Studies (72 papers), Spectroscopy and Quantum Chemical Studies (38 papers) and Crystallography and molecular interactions (18 papers). Alicia Torre is often cited by papers focused on Advanced Chemical Physics Studies (72 papers), Spectroscopy and Quantum Chemical Studies (38 papers) and Crystallography and molecular interactions (18 papers). Alicia Torre collaborates with scholars based in Argentina, Spain and Czechia. Alicia Torre's co-authors include Luis Laín, Roberto C. Bochicchio, Diego R. Alcoba, Robert Ponec, Ofelia B. Oña, Gustavo E. Massaccesi, G. Dattoli, R. Mignani, Patrick Bultinck and Dimitri Van Neck and has published in prestigious journals such as The Journal of Chemical Physics, Physical Review A and Chemical Physics Letters.
